TrackVia is a market leading enterprise software platform focused on delivering compliance

lifecycle management systems for federal government agencies, public sector entities, and

Global 2000 enterprises across all industry verticals. The company's comprehensive cloud-

based solutions support real-time insights for accurate decision support for risk mitigation

activities, noncompliance workflows and exception reporting, and monitoring of specific

regulatory deadline requirements.

TrackVia was an early innovator in low-code/no-code application architectures and delivers

core AI-enabled features throughout its platform. TrackVia's FedRAMP authorization

underscores its commitment to security and compliance, enabling deployment in highly

regulated environments and reinforcing trust across all industries it serves. A partial sampling of

their marquee clients include Amentum, Brighthouse Financial, Northside Hospital, and Star

Entertainment Group. The company is headquartered in Denver, Colorado. This role may be in Denver or Remote.
